Doc Text: |
Previously, Python programs that used "ulimit -n" to enable communication with large numbers of subprocesses could still monitor only 1024 file descriptors at a time, due to the subprocess module using the "select" system call. This could cause an exception:
ValueError: filedescriptor out of range in select()
The module now uses the "poll" system call, removing this limitation.
